This porcelain incense burner was thrown on a wheel then altered by throwing it on a stone slab then shaped and dried in a cotton sling. It was fired to vitrification for strength and durability. The porcelain is made from New Zealand kaolin which is the purest (and most expensive) kaolin in the world.
About 4 1/4 inches long and 3 1/2 inches wide.
